Product Description

Get your tail-feathers in a spin with some fabulous falconry in Yorkshire! Meet majestic birds of prey & watch them soar through the skies above the beautiful North Yorkshire countryside on this 1200 acre estate. The emphasis is on giving participants a real hands-on experience getting to know the birds & understanding their behaviour as they are flown in fields & woodland

Before handling any of the falcons hawks owls kites & kestrels trained & cared for by the North Yorkshire falconry team you’ll be fully briefed on what the birds themselves will be expecting from you as well as how to approach the bird lift it from its perch & for those choosing the falconry experiences a demonstration on how to use the falconer's knot to tie & untie the bird’s leash & secure it safely on your fist.

After this initial lesson half-day participants have the chance to fly a team of Harris Hawks in the surrounding woods & fields for the rest of the morning learning the different methods & techniques used. The experience concludes with a photo-call with the birds & in total the activity lasts Approx. two & a half hours.

Full-day falconry courses at this wonderful Yorkshire centre follows the same itinerary as the half day in the morning then is followed by a light lunch taken in the field or if the weather is poor at a traditional Yorkshire pub. The afternoon session then sees you heading to the falcon flying arena where you’ll discover just how these impressive birds are exercised to the lure.  A photo opportunity rounds off this regal full day to perfection along with a final question & answer session.
